Μετατροπή μορφών ηλεκτρονικού ταχυδρομείου Outlook και Thunderbird μέσω C #

Microsoft® Μετατροπή και ανάλυση αρχείων Outlook και Thunderbird για τη δημιουργία εφαρμογών .NET πολλαπλών πλατφορμών

 

.NET Email API για τη δημιουργία λύσεων επεξεργασίας αλληλογραφίας πολλαπλών πλατφορμών που έχουν τη δυνατότητα δημιουργίας, χειρισμού, επεξεργασίας, μετατροπής και μετάδοσης μηνυμάτων χωρίς την εγκατάσταση του Microsoft Outlook®. Οι προγραμματιστές μπορούν εύκολα να βελτιώσουν εφαρμογές για λειτουργίες όπως προσθήκη, λήψη ή κατάργηση συνημμένων από ένα αντικείμενο μηνύματος, προσαρμογή κεφαλίδων μηνυμάτων αλλάζοντας το θέμα, προσθήκη ή κατάργηση παραληπτών και πολλά άλλα.

Μετατροπή μηνυμάτων ηλεκτρονικού ταχυδρομείου σε διάφορες μορφές αρχείων

Οι προγραμματιστές μπορούν εύκολα να μετατρέψουν μορφές ηλεκτρονικού ταχυδρομείου ενσωματώνοντας API χωρίς να εισέλθουν στις εσωτερικές λεπτομέρειες των υποκείμενων προδιαγραφών μορφής. Η διαδικασία μετατροπής είναι απλή φορτώνοντας πρώτα την πηγή χρησιμοποιώντας MailMessage.Load και καλώντας το Μέθοδος αποθήκευσης έχοντας το αρχείο εξόδου και SaveOptions.DefaultFormat ως παράμετροι.

Κωδικός C # για μετατροπή MSG σε EML
// Load the Message file
using (var msgtoEml = MailMessage.Load(dir + "sourceFile.msg"))
{
// save in EML format
msgtoEml.Save(dir + "convertedfile.eml", SaveOptions.DefaultEml);
}
view raw msg-to-eml.cs hosted with ❤ by GitHub
Κώδικας C# για μετατροπή MSG σε HTML
// Load the Message file
using (var msgtoHTML = MailMessage.Load(dir + "GetHTMLFilefrom.msg"))
{
// save in HTML formats
msgtoHTML.Save(dir + "savefile.html", SaveOptions.DefaultHtml);
}
view raw msg-to-html.cs hosted with ❤ by GitHub
Κωδικός C# για μετατροπή MSG σε MHTML
// Load the Message file
using (var msgtoMHTML = MailMessage.Load(dir + "ConvertMHTMLFilefrom.msg"))
{
// save in MHTML format
msgtoMHTML.Save(dir + "output.mhtml", SaveOptions.DefaultMhtml);
}
view raw msg-to-mhtml.cs hosted with ❤ by GitHub